India’s stainless steel industry calls for greater government support

India’s stainless steel industry is operating at only 60% of its 7.5 million ton capacity, prompting domestic producers to call for stronger government support to curb imports and improve utilization. 

Current measures, including Quality Control Orders (QCOs) and temporary safeguard duties, are seen as insufficient. Industry leaders have requested special import investigations and stricter import regulations to protect domestic market share. 

Aligned with the government’s “self-reliance” initiative, Indian stainless steel companies plan significant capacity expansion. With domestic steel prices dropping, the industry is seeking effective policy support to boost utilization and growth.
